A devastated bride-to-be ditched her fiancé and shed almost half her bodyweight after learning he was cheating on her.

Emily Donovan, 24, from Margam, Port Talbot, Wales, lost her confidence and called off her wedding after discovering her partner had not been faithful. 

But the move inspired Ms Donovan, who was 15-and-a-half stone at the time, to get healthy – and she ditched her diet of takeaways, sandwiches, and crisps.  

She said: ‘I think that was what kicked off my weight loss because it affected my self-confidence.

‘Before I didn’t want to go out and get dressed up because I didn’t want to have my picture taken. It’s almost as if I missed a chapter of my life.’

Ms Donovan, who works at the Tata Steel works in Port Talbot, took up regular running, going to the gym and healthy eating to lose more than six stone.

She said: ‘At my heaviest in September last year I was 15 stone and nine pounds and now I weigh nine stone.

‘I went on holiday before I joined Slimming World to try and get over my heartbreak and that was when I decided to join.

‘I vowed to be more active but I wasn’t fit enough when I first started. Alongside Slimming World I signed up for Couch to 5k and my dad started running with me.

‘It has been the best thing to happen to me and I’ve got my confidence back now.’

The Tata Steel worker said she had been an overweight child but had previously lost weight with Slimming World before she began to ‘comfort eat’ during a five year relationship with her ex.

She sad: ‘I got comfortable and I was eating what he was eating and not really thinking about what I was eating – I was just comfortable and happy.

‘I never used to cook before. I would buy in or go out for food with my friends and boyfriend.

‘It would always be meals to go, sandwiches and crisps. Sometimes I would miss meals and have loads of snacks instead.’

Ms Donovan says she now enjoys home-cooked meals and spends far more time exercising.

She said: ‘Since joining Slimming World I cook all of my own meals now like spaghetti bolognese, chicken pie and shepherd’s pie but my favourites are the curries because I’m really into Indian food and that’s what I used to binge on.

‘My life has changed definitely with the running and being more active.

‘Before I wouldn’t even go for a walk but now I go out walking on the weekends – the dog is loving it.

‘I never would have thought I could do a Parkrun. I have reached a 10k but hopefully I can do that in a race soon.

‘Since I’ve lost the weight everybody can’t get over it. They all say they see a difference in me and that my confidence has come a long way.

‘I lost the last three stone during lockdown as I seemed to get more motivated. I just saw it as a chance to make a real go of it when it came to exercising, eating and being active.’
